SCG11443 - Côte d’Ivoire – 1c River Canoe Scene, French West Africa (Afrique Occidentale Française) Colonial Issue

A beautifully engraved low-value definitive from Côte d’Ivoire, issued under French West Africa administration, featuring a traditional river canoe with local figures navigating calm tropical waters. The detailed vignette captures daily life and transport along West African waterways, framed by tribal art motifs and colonial typography. Printed in a striking two-tone purple-brown, this early 20th-century design is part of the classic A.O.F. pictorial series. Popular with collectors for its ethnographic artwork and regional history. A desirable foundational piece for French colonies, Africa, and canoe/transport thematic collections.
